Simplicity

Keeter C

 

I’m a simple man,

And that’s what entertains.

Too deep I delve.

The world transforms day to day.

I know not complex or what it reflects.

The simplest things I have lost.

The complexities perhaps in my brain may remain.

This night the dream might return.
